一维数组

演示一维数组的创建和使用,并将结果打印到控制台。

package ch2;

public class ArrayDemo {

	public static void main(String[] args) {
		// 声明一个整形数组a
		int a[];
		//给数组a分配十个整型空间
		a=new int[10];
		//定义一个单精度浮点型数组b,同时给数组分配5个浮点型空间
		float b[]=new float[5];
		//定义一个长度为20的字符型数组c
		char c[]=new char[20];
		//定义一个长度为5的双精度浮点型数组
		double d[]=new double[5];
		//定义一个长度为5的布尔型数组
		boolean e[]=new boolean[5];
		/*下面输出各数组的数组名,注意输出的内容*/
		System.out.println(a);
		System.out.println(b);
		System.out.println(c);
		System.out.println(d);
		System.out.println(e);
		System.out.println("---------------");
		/*下面输出各数组中第一个元素的值,注意输出的内容*/
		System.out.println(a[0]);
		System.out.println(b[0]);
		System.out.println(c[0]);
		System.out.println(d[0]);
		System.out.println(e[0]);
		System.out.println("---------------");
		System.out.println("a.length="+a.length);
		System.out.println("b.length="+b.length);
		System.out.println("c.length="+c.length);
		System.out.println("d.length="+d.length);
		System.out.println("e.length="+e.length);
	}

}

一维数组